I created a banner to celebrate St. Patrick's Day with festive St. Patty's Day papers I had in my stash.


Spellbinders Nested Pennants and Nested Lacy Pennants were used for the banner. The green cardstock was embossed with a Cuttlebug Distressed Stripes embossing folder. "Happy" is from a Stampendous Happy Messages stamp set. The letters for St. Pat's are Die-Versions Downhill Fonts.
